The US Supreme Court has reinstated the death penalty for Dzhokhar Tsarnaev, the bomber of the Boston marathon who in 2013, together with his brother, caused the death of three people and the injuries of 260 others. A federal court overturned the sentence against the young man of Chechen origin, upholding the appeal presented by his lawyers.
A month later, then President Donald Trump called for the death penalty to be reinstated.
